
Kiyoko Tachibana, a student at an integrated middle and high school for girls in Tokyo, met Akari Okusawa, who was wearing a bright blue dress, at the start of the new school year in her first year of high school. In contrast to the other students, Akari freely interacts with everyone and quickly becomes popular, and Kiyoko is attracted to her. Kiyoko's newly awakened feelings for her soon involve the whole class, and the situation develops into a disturbance.
